DEV Community

Shrutik
Shrutik

Posted on

Building CoralTeams: An AI-Powered Operational Intelligence Platform with Coral

🌊 Introduction

During the Pirates of the Coral-bean Hackathon, our team Hubble Telescope set out to solve a problem that almost every engineering organization faces:

Β«Critical operational information is scattered across too many tools.Β»

Modern teams rely on platforms like GitHub, Slack, monitoring dashboards, cloud providers, and security tools to keep systems running. While these tools are individually powerful, they often create a fragmented operational experience.

When incidents happen, engineers spend valuable time switching between dashboards, searching for context, correlating events, and gathering information before they can even begin solving the problem.

We asked ourselves:

What if operational intelligence lived in one place?

That question led to the creation of CoralTeams β€” an AI-powered Operational Intelligence Platform built on Coral that unifies monitoring, investigations, collaboration, and AI-driven insights into a single workspace.

What made this journey even more exciting was that Coral wasn't just our platformβ€”it became our engineering partner throughout the entire development lifecycle.


🎯 The Problem

Consider a common production scenario:

A deployment goes live.

Minutes later:

  • 🚨 Error rates spike
  • πŸ“ˆ Monitoring alerts begin firing
  • πŸ’¬ Incident channels become active
  • πŸ” Engineers start investigating
  • ☁️ Cloud systems generate operational events

The response process usually looks like this:

  • GitHub for deployment history
  • Slack for communication
  • Monitoring tools for alerts
  • Cloud dashboards for infrastructure status
  • Internal tools for operational context

The result?

❌ Constant context switching
❌ Fragmented information
❌ Slower incident resolution

We wanted to eliminate that friction.


πŸ΄β€β˜ οΈ Introducing CoralTeams

CoralTeams is an AI-powered Operational Intelligence & Collaboration Platform designed to centralize operational workflows.

Instead of treating alerts, investigations, communication, and analysis as separate processes, CoralTeams brings everything together into one unified operational workspace.

Core Objectives

βœ… Operational Visibility

βœ… Structured Investigations

βœ… AI-Powered Intelligence

βœ… Team Collaboration

βœ… Faster Incident Response


πŸ“Š Operational Command Center

The Operational Command Center serves as the real-time heartbeat of the platform.

It provides teams with instant visibility into the state of their environment through:

  • Active Incident Monitoring
  • Critical Alert Tracking
  • Operational Metrics
  • Integration Health Monitoring
  • Live Activity Streams
  • Role-Based Dashboards

Rather than opening multiple dashboards, users can immediately understand what's happening across their organization.

One dashboard.

One source of truth.


πŸ”Ž Investigation Center

The Investigation Center is where CoralTeams truly shines.

Most platforms stop at alert generation.

We wanted to help teams answer the next question:

"What actually happened?"

Each investigation is transformed into a structured workflow containing:

  • Incident Timelines
  • Evidence Collections
  • Related Operational Events
  • Investigation Graphs
  • Analyst Activity Logs
  • System Context

Instead of manually stitching together information from multiple platforms, analysts can view the complete story in one place.

This dramatically reduces investigation time and improves decision-making.


πŸ€– AI Analysis Engine

Operational environments generate enormous amounts of data.

The challenge isn't collecting information.

The challenge is understanding it.

To address this, CoralTeams includes an AI Analysis Engine capable of transforming raw operational signals into actionable intelligence.

Features

πŸ“„ Executive Summaries

Quick explanations of incidents and events.

πŸ” Root Cause Analysis

Identification of likely causes behind operational disruptions.

🌐 Impact Assessment

Understanding which systems and services were affected.

πŸ”— Correlation Insights

Connecting signals originating from different tools and systems.

πŸ“Š Confidence Scores

Providing transparency into AI-generated conclusions.

⚑ Recommended Actions

Actionable next steps for engineers and analysts.

The goal is simple:

Turn operational noise into operational intelligence.


πŸ‘₯ Role-Based Access Control (RBAC)

Different users need different levels of visibility.

CoralTeams implements Role-Based Access Control to ensure every user sees what matters most.

Admin

  • Platform Health
  • User Management
  • Integration Status
  • Organizational Metrics
  • Configuration Controls

Analyst

  • Incident Investigations
  • Evidence Analysis
  • AI Insights
  • Operational Workflows

Viewer

  • Read-Only Dashboards
  • Incident Status Updates
  • Operational Visibility

πŸͺΈ How Coral Accelerated Development

One of our primary goals during the hackathon was exploring how Coral could improve engineering productivity.

The result exceeded our expectations.

Coral became much more than an AI coding assistant.

It acted as a collaborative engineering teammate.


πŸ—οΈ Architecture Planning

Coral helped us define:

  • Frontend Architecture
  • Backend Services
  • API Contracts
  • Data Models
  • Investigation Flows

This allowed us to establish a scalable foundation before writing production code.


🎨 Frontend Development

Coral accelerated the creation of:

  • Authentication Systems
  • RBAC Flows
  • Operational Dashboards
  • Investigation Interfaces
  • AI Analysis Views
  • Shared Component Libraries

Rapid iteration allowed us to continuously improve UX throughout development.


βš™οΈ Backend Design

Coral assisted with:

  • API Design
  • Service Abstractions
  • Integration Planning
  • Database Modeling
  • Frontend-Backend Contracts

This reduced development overhead and improved team coordination.


πŸ“š Documentation & Workflow Design

Coral also supported:

  • Technical Documentation
  • Architecture Validation
  • Workflow Design
  • Engineering Planning
  • Development Strategy

This enabled us to spend more time solving real problems and less time searching for solutions.


πŸ›οΈ Technical Architecture

Frontend

  • Next.js
  • TypeScript
  • Tailwind CSS

Backend

  • Node.js
  • REST APIs
  • Authentication Services
  • RBAC Middleware

Architecture Principles

  • Service-Oriented Design
  • Typed Contracts
  • Shared Service Layers
  • Reusable Components
  • Integration-Ready Architecture

This foundation makes future scaling significantly easier.


πŸ”Œ Integration Strategy

CoralTeams was designed to be integration-first.

Potential integrations include:

  • GitHub
  • Slack
  • Sentry
  • Datadog
  • Notion
  • Cloud Platforms

The vision is to transform isolated operational signals into unified investigations and actionable intelligence.


βš”οΈ Challenges We Faced

Information Density

Operational environments produce massive volumes of data.

The challenge was balancing visibility with simplicity.

We wanted users to access critical information without overwhelming them.


Investigation Workflow Design

Building dashboards was relatively straightforward.

Designing effective investigation workflows was much harder.

Significant effort went into determining how evidence, timelines, events, and AI insights should interact.


Team Coordination

With frontend, backend, and AI development happening simultaneously, maintaining architectural consistency became essential.

Coral helped us stay aligned throughout the project.


πŸ“– Key Learnings

One lesson stood out throughout development:

Β«Data alone doesn't create value. Understanding does.Β»

Operational information already exists.

The real challenge is organizing it into workflows that help people make faster and better decisions.

By combining visibility, investigations, collaboration, and AI-powered reasoning, CoralTeams enables teams to move from detection to resolution with greater speed and confidence.


πŸš€ What's Next?

Our roadmap includes:

  • Advanced Monitoring Integrations
  • Correlation Engines
  • Automated Incident Response
  • Cloud-Native Observability
  • Enhanced AI Reasoning
  • Expanded Collaboration Features

The goal is to continue evolving CoralTeams into a complete operational intelligence platform.


πŸŽ‰ Conclusion

CoralTeams was built around a simple belief:

Operational Intelligence should be Unified, Collaborative, and Actionable.

By bringing together investigations, operational signals, AI-powered analysis, and team collaboration, CoralTeams transforms fragmented information into a single operational workspace.

The Pirates of the Coral-bean Hackathon gave us the opportunity to explore not only what we could buildβ€”but how quickly we could build it with Coral.

From planning and architecture to implementation and iteration, Coral played a critical role in helping us focus on solving meaningful problems.

CoralTeams represents our vision for a future where teams spend less time switching between tools and more time making informed decisions.

One Platform.

One Investigation Flow.

One Source of Operational Truth.


🏷️ Tags

AI #DevOps #Coral #Hackathon #OperationalIntelligence #IncidentResponse #SoftwareEngineering #NextJS #TypeScript #NodeJS #ArtificialIntelligence #OpenSource #ProductDevelopment #Engineering #DeveloperTools #CloudComputing #Observability #TeamCollaboration #CoralBean #BuildInPublic

Top comments (0)